This was reported by the Main Intelligence Directorate of the Ministry of Defense of Ukraine.
On February 20 at 6:05, a gray Renault Duster exploded near a house on East Avenue in the temporarily occupied Berdyansk. The vehicle was completely destroyed by the fire, and Russian occupation services arrived at the scene.
Inside the car was Yevgeny Bogdanov — a citizen of Russia, who formally held the position of so-called Deputy Head of the Occupation Administration of Berdyansk.
The responsibilities of the Russian invader included, among other things, overseeing finances within the occupation administration and organizing the construction of fortifications in the temporarily occupied areas of the Zaporizhia region.
The GUR states that during his time in the occupied Ukrainian territories, Yevgeny Bogdanov repeatedly committed war crimes against Ukrainian citizens.
Bogdanov was born in 1970 in the city of Pikalevo, Leningrad Oblast, Russia. He arrived in Berdyansk immediately after the city was captured by Russian troops in 2022. His appointment to the occupation administration was made by Russian special services.
